Ottawa Pinball Show ticket prices increase after August 12

Pinball Medics says the five-day Ottawa Pinball Show will run August 26-30 at Experience Social, 250 Greenbank Road in Ottawa. The organizer lists approximately 120 machines spanning pre-war games, classics, current releases, arcade video games, and IFPA-sanctioned competition. Early-bird pricing ends after August 12: one day is $25 before the increase, Saturday-Sunday is $40, Friday-Sunday is $50, and all five days are $60. The listed prices include HST.

Why it matters

The useful deadline is August 12, not the opening-day countdown. A full-event pass rises by $15 after that date, while the one-day and weekend options each rise by $5 or $10. The machine count and programming are organizer-published plans, not a guarantee that every listed game or session will be available at every hour. The organizer lists the show for Wednesday, August 26 through Sunday, August 30, 2026. Announced admission before the August 12 increase is $25 for one day, $40 for Saturday-Sunday, $50 for Friday-Sunday, or $60 for all five days; HST is included. The venue also lists a mandatory $2 coat or bag check and restrictions on outside drinks and full meals.

Who gets the most from the show: The event combines unlimited play, current-production demos, historical machines, tournaments, repair demonstrations, seminars, parts pickup, and machines offered for sale. That makes the multi-day passes more relevant to tournament players and buyers than to visitors planning a short casual stop.

Frequently Asked Questions

When is the Ottawa Pinball Show 2026?

The Ottawa Pinball Show is scheduled for August 26-30, 2026 at Experience Social, 250 Greenbank Road in Ottawa. The organizer describes it as a five-day event with approximately 120 pinball machines.

When do Ottawa Pinball Show ticket prices increase?

Pinball Medics lists early-bird pricing through August 12. After that date, one-day passes rise from $25 to $30, Saturday-Sunday passes from $40 to $50, Friday-Sunday passes from $50 to $65, and full-event passes from $60 to $75.

What is included at the Ottawa Pinball Show?

The announced program includes approximately 120 machines, unlimited play, IFPA-sanctioned competition, repair demonstrations, seminars, historical exhibits, parts pickup, and late-model machines available to play before buying. Final schedules and featured games may still change.
